What Is a Dedicated Server?

A dedicated server is a physical machine rented entirely by one customer. You get exclusive access to the CPU, RAM, storage, and bandwidth — no sharing with other users, no noisy neighbors.

According to IONOS:

“A dedicated server provides exclusive access to all system resources, ensuring consistent performance and high reliability.”

This makes it ideal for:

  • High-traffic websites
  • Game servers
  • Databases
  • SaaS platforms
  • Security-sensitive applications

In contrast, shared hosting splits one server among hundreds of users, while VPS hosting partitions a single server into virtual machines. Both are cheaper but share the same physical resources — which means performance can fluctuate under load.

With dedicated hosting, the hardware is yours alone.

The Real Cost of a Cheap Dedicated Server

According to HostingAdvice, the cheapest reliable dedicated servers start around $35–$45/month.

ProviderStarting PriceFeatures
Hetzner€37.30/monthAMD Ryzen, NVMe SSD, DDoS protection
Namecheap$44.88/monthIntel Xeon, Managed support optional
OVHcloud$49/monthGlobal datacenters, 1 Gbps bandwidth
IONOS$45/monthInstant setup, 24/7 support
InterServer$49/monthCustom configurations, free migration

Tip: “Cheap” is relative — it means better value, not necessarily the lowest cost.
Ultra-low-price servers below $25 often sacrifice reliability or security.

Core Features You Should Look For

Before purchasing any dedicated server, verify that these essential features are included.

1. Hardware Specs

  • CPU: Intel Xeon E-Series / AMD EPYC
  • RAM: Minimum 16 GB DDR4
  • Storage: NVMe SSD for faster data access

2. Security

Look for DDoS protection, firewall configuration, and data center certifications (ISO 27001 or Tier III).

3. Network & Bandwidth

At least 1 Gbps connection with unlimited or high data transfer limits.

4. Full Root Access

Allows software customization, OS choice (Linux, Windows), and security hardening.

5. 24/7 Support

Make sure the provider offers 24/7 technical support — preferably through live chat or phone.

6. Scalability Options

The ability to upgrade hardware later without downtime is crucial for growing businesses.

Step-by-Step Buying Guide

Step 1— Define Your Requirements

List what you’ll host: a website, app, game server, or database. Estimate CPU, memory, and bandwidth needs.

Step 2— Choose Managed or Unmanaged

  • Managed servers handle maintenance and security for you.
  • Unmanaged servers are cheaper but require technical knowledge.

Step 3— Check the Hardware

Minimum 4-core CPU, 16 GB RAM, SSD/NVMe storage.

Step 4— Verify Data Center Location

Pick a data center close to your target audience to minimize latency.

Step 5— Security and Compliance

Ensure features like DDoS protection, SSL compatibility, and 24/7 monitoring.

Step 6— Review Support Options

Read real customer reviews (Trustpilot, G2). Instant response and uptime guarantees matter.

Step 7— Compare Renewal Prices

Some hosts lure you in with cheap first-month pricing, then hike rates — always check renewal costs.
